Quellcode durchsuchen

[js] update 0http js 1.2.1 to 4.3.0 (#10035)

rio vor 1 Monat
Ursprung
Commit
3f11c708f5

+ 1 - 1
frameworks/JavaScript/0http/0http.dockerfile

@@ -1,4 +1,4 @@
-FROM node:10
+FROM node:20.16-slim
 
 WORKDIR /usr/src/app
 

+ 2 - 6
frameworks/JavaScript/0http/app.js

@@ -1,9 +1,5 @@
 const cero = require('0http')
-const low = require('0http/lib/server/low')
-
-const { router, server } = cero({
-  server: low()
-})
+const { router, server } = cero()
 
 router.on('GET', '/json', (req, res) => {
   res.setHeader('server', '0http')
@@ -19,4 +15,4 @@ router.on('GET', '/plaintext', (req, res) => {
   res.end('Hello, World!')
 })
 
-server.start(8080, socket => {})
+server.listen(8080)

+ 1 - 2
frameworks/JavaScript/0http/package.json

@@ -1,8 +1,7 @@
 {
   "name": "0http",
   "dependencies": {
-    "0http": "1.2.1",
-    "uWebSockets.js": "github:uNetworking/uWebSockets.js#v15.11.0"
+    "0http": "4.3.0"
   },
   "main": "app.js"
 }